> You can start with 5 and increment by 5. So you need not reboot each
> time, compile tdfxfb as a module, and set CONFIG_HW_CONSOLE_BINDING=y
> (under drivers->char).

I've done that for testing, but I haven't build that kernel yet (not
spare time by now).

> Make sure you have vbetool, and use the attached script.

I don't have vbetool, but I'll get it.

> The script assumes vbetool is in /usr/sbin, if not just edit. Also,
> unbinding will only work if X (or any graphics app, for that matter) is
> not loaded.
